Hajj: Kwara pilgrims, hale, healthy after Arafat - Official

Date: 2019-08-13

All the 2,026 Kwara pilgrims performing the 2019 hajj in Saudi Arabia are hale and healthy after performing the symbolic prayer at the plain of Arafat, the Executive Secretary of the State Pilgrims Welfare Board, Alhaji Mohammed Tunde-Jimoh has revealed.

Tunde-Jimoh said this on Monday in a telephone interview with the News Agency of Nigeria from Muna, Saudi Arabia.

The ES also said that all the pilgrims, including officials, successfully performed Eid-el-Kabir without any casualty.

He also disclosed that the pilgrims, in high spirit, had performed the throwing of pebbles at the devil, twice in Muna and were expected to perform the last of such religious rite "any moment from now."

The ES said the pilgrims also prayed for peace, unity, love and prosperity for Kwara State in particular and Nigeria at large.

Speaking in a similar vein, the state Amirul Hajj, Alhaji Lasisi Kolawole-Jimoh, said feeding and accommodation of the state's pilgrims in Makkah and Madinah were satisfactory.
